A PwC report indicates that the Sunbelt will lead the real estate market in 2025, with Dallas-Fort Worth (DFW) as the top market. DFW has experienced an 11.2% employment growth since February 2020 and boasts a diverse economy. Home prices have risen nearly 38% to a median of $382,000, remaining competitive with the national median. DFW has achieved annualized returns of 8.8% over the past decade, making it attractive for new residents and businesses. Additionally, the Metroplex was highlighted as the most appealing investment market in the U.S.
